ovirt-cockpit-sso-0.1.4-2.oe24090>    f! ;G|`u` O grd9à%j&wQOSc@&GҥN&; *pSizrZD fzi[pڂ {#heLE+0R~O$1`G m"4_QgӒ,=u/+7 Fe/$u(~bGzOێ~B y*?@9@`5*£:U]١WO/aQ*"K6ULMm7"'fYCt"5tG:ZI,IڢehlGsˡCtim?\ vĿy'+< Ξo-ѦKUPadu*kgW?XL03476f85ab8795c03b766b334cff2605798ab2a09f390fbfb9211a4599ca12edd3c2ecb51569fa3e6bee92d86156690368923687KF1kXWuU}Z>7D?4d # \(,4 IUt    F HPZdl(89:(AqFxGHIRXY\]^def \`Covirt-cockpit-sso0.1.42.oe2409Provides SSO from oVirt Administration Portal to CockpitThis package sets cockpit-ws service (see cockpit-project.org) to provide SSO (Single Sign On) from oVirt's Administration Portal to Cockpit running on an oVirt's host machine.f!dc-64g.compass-ci8ASL 2.0http://openeuler.orgUnspecifiedovirt-cockpit-sso-0.1.4.tar.gzhttps://github.com/oVirt/ovirt-cockpit-ssolinuxnoarch)f!^f!^27e8aec89ddfbb543b4a4cde7e907adf1f9ee262f359d2235579691b28f971f799abbc499d7b13e98f5c1129fea4204327d8562ecd39c1ebb674f2fd215c8c7a rootrootrootrootovirt-cockpit-sso  rpmlib(CompressedFileNames)rpmlib(FileDigests)3.0.4-14.6.0-14.18.2b1@`Ewangdi - 0.1.4-2weishaokun - 0.1.4- fix warning of failing to delete files when uninstall- update packagenoarchdc-64g.compass-ci 17266855780.1.4-2.oe2409ovirt-cockpit-sso-0.1.4.tar.gzovirt-cockpit-sso.speccpiogzip9utf-8a9e0ceec4e6988360c88989ce49e967608a613265e8803339501512cc3d7eb4b3c0cd1f293f2bea37b959168a510cec0a49b7aaa8d174dd1924adde70e4ac43dName: ovirt-cockpit-sso Version: 0.1.4 Release: 2 Summary: Provides SSO from oVirt Administration Portal to Cockpit License: ASL 2.0 URL: https://github.com/oVirt/ovirt-cockpit-sso Source0: https://resources.ovirt.org/pub/src/ovirt-cockpit-sso/ovirt-cockpit-sso-0.1.4.tar.gz BuildArch: noarch Conflicts: ovirt-engine < 4.4 Requires: cockpit-ws >= 140 Requires: cockpit-dashboard >= 140 Requires: python3 %description This package sets cockpit-ws service (see cockpit-project.org) to provide SSO (Single Sign On) from oVirt's Administration Portal to Cockpit running on an oVirt's host machine. %prep cd '/home/lkp/rpmbuild/BUILD' rm -rf 'ovirt-cockpit-sso-0.1.4' /usr/lib/rpm/rpmuncompress -x '/home/lkp/rpmbuild/SOURCES/ovirt-cockpit-sso-0.1.4.tar.gz' STATUS=$? if [ $STATUS -ne 0 ]; then exit $STATUS fi cd 'ovirt-cockpit-sso-0.1.4' /usr/bin/chmod -Rf a+rX,u+w,g-w,o-w . %install mkdir -p /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/share/ovirt-cockpit-sso/config/cockpit mkdir -p /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/lib/systemd/system/ cp container/config/cockpit/cockpit.conf /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/share/ovirt-cockpit-sso/config/cockpit/. cp container/cockpit-auth-ovirt /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/share/ovirt-cockpit-sso/. cp container/keygen.sh /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/share/ovirt-cockpit-sso/. cp start.sh /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/share/ovirt-cockpit-sso/. cp prestart.sh /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/share/ovirt-cockpit-sso/. cp ovirt-cockpit-sso.xml /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/share/ovirt-cockpit-sso/. cp ovirt-cockpit-sso.service /home/lkp/rpmbuild/BUILDROOT/ovirt-cockpit-sso-0.1.4-2.oe2409.x86_64/usr/lib/systemd/system/. %post HOSTNAME=$(hostname -f) ROOT_DIR=$(echo /usr/share/ovirt-cockpit-sso | sed -e 's/\\/\\\\/g; s/\//\\\//g; s/&/\\\&/g') case "$1" in 1) echo configuring firewall for ovirt-cockpit-sso service - accept 9986/tcp > /var/log/ovirt-cockpit-sso.install.log echo Post-installation configuration of ovirt-cockpit-sso - setting engine FQDN to: ${HOSTNAME} >> /var/log/ovirt-cockpit-sso.install.log ## /bin/firewall-cmd --permanent --zone=public --new-service-from-file=%{app_root_dir}/ovirt-cockpit-sso.xml /bin/firewall-cmd --permanent --add-port 9986/tcp >> /var/log/ovirt-cockpit-sso.install.log /bin/firewall-cmd --reload >> /var/log/ovirt-cockpit-sso.install.log ;; 2) ## This is an upgrade. ;; esac /bin/sed -i "s/\%\%ENGINE_URL\%\%/https:\/\/${HOSTNAME}\/ovirt-engine/g" /usr/share/ovirt-cockpit-sso/config/cockpit/cockpit.conf /bin/sed -i "s/\%\%INSTALL_DIR\%\%/${ROOT_DIR}/g" /usr/share/ovirt-cockpit-sso/config/cockpit/cockpit.conf %postun case "$1" in 0) ## package is being removed if [[ -e /usr/share/ovirt-cockpit-sso/config/cockpit/ws-certs.d ]]; then rm /usr/share/ovirt-cockpit-sso/config/cockpit/ws-certs.d || true fi if [[ -e /usr/share/ovirt-cockpit-sso/ca.pem ]]; then rm /usr/share/ovirt-cockpit-sso/ca.pem || true fi ## TODO: this is not working but would be better approach: ## /bin/firewall-cmd --permanent --zone=public --delete-service=ovirt-cockpit-sso /bin/firewall-cmd --permanent --remove-port 9986/tcp >> /var/log/ovirt-cockpit-sso.install.log || true /bin/firewall-cmd --reload >> /var/log/ovirt-cockpit-sso.install.log ;; 1) ## Package is being upgraded. Do nothing. : ;; esac # the .service file could be changed systemctl daemon-reload %files %doc README.md %license LICENSE /usr/share/ovirt-cockpit-sso/config/cockpit/cockpit.conf /usr/share/ovirt-cockpit-sso/cockpit-auth-ovirt /usr/share/ovirt-cockpit-sso/keygen.sh /usr/share/ovirt-cockpit-sso/start.sh /usr/share/ovirt-cockpit-sso/prestart.sh /usr/share/ovirt-cockpit-sso/ovirt-cockpit-sso.xml /usr/lib/systemd/system/ovirt-cockpit-sso.service %config %verify(not md5 size mtime) /usr/share/ovirt-cockpit-sso/config/cockpit/cockpit.conf %changelog * Wed Mar 16 2022 wangdi - 0.1.4-2 - fix warning of failing to delete files when uninstall * Tue Jul 06 2021 weishaokun - 0.1.4 - update package ?zXT?J:tH ݒҍ0303AttIJtHI(-)];=~~晽^o]7l^^^>_]Z_|`k~>!Հ_ ,]|Op$rtGr!0.^n>nAn  ASʲ@Cߐ7Zl/=.$.L"HmjݥYY|Mtq岘XZrSV702{̿/KZ?3t7xrtZSR0fOc.f)ǫj6N V_G7N.8>/x_:-Dv_NO'/_*:]),X؆/–NN ..V/(uGXhȂ ￉znyI)RHh񡷁ɪu<)m8£>[Lm^/<6#*CH _n4S2Ė.-㘁}AwZīåi{&D7-h~OmjN){TH"m:I~ny6pF(k Nl!3XeJe8M,؂;8C_=xuf~qst6[3!^wԹE#*&# $-<6"7M{x .ډU~w!z_@.]ˮ89M(+)-yZ_U8LG7Î: -M5@6:):@` oۏNfFx=6Yk\>wf%{J4a>W{UwaT/`4'>˖k-ԩy~Sn]|dNtGa_.K<-A~{0逯w;wdH}j9]cYG}ǗАP i>Զ1\VzeJu/HP *z=0jݩ[E0Vcp\2aMk(?\`iw8oP!= &yX\="#ouCMCW֖*3f6T:  q:6E|n+ %2<Gddpj"ѐatdg$/NVQl,#viVju&tʾOsx$NRs0:樄[xf*HO"OyX+ړw=y=d"o;ʙ?`0NJ>|O?F>ǝ:4K^V_Ifj'T ?`+7db|w" 4L%3לfvD̮3bmYT8kIls0:(|#p(ΐ9~`U 0h2I(I~-g6762~j SS`u `H<7ǁ ꄥhބ/vlU|MqYo{F[x+ݡ+as ^Sֻ;A^}.'}vO$IFZUDJMqkQn@7wD tuL/o ncІ<3Vȏ>͝,2}(\ORږ] ZzLCF9mL!+U!?E":MԲ- PwpZn$wC5Gt"yzzK\+YK[KCtӣ+d`:m.ލgn!_#z7r44P>JS֭(.d bprɏ,V5݈4d ՍMؘ:?A;Ë [3RO/ˇ6e[GJE~l`pRf T~ .2}zpќ5]bӄ a-WQ@cNPH#(Y77A$ل()%Wc;ȤYA?Jڦ;qH*?/"QWE? i_}e}V'Rpٷ jy26ϕYM^xx 2%0&?aOF1ӯ7_*(9ݷ]S\ޗ7 ]% * uM yݝCzl*e+oКwoB!V"ͧK֤jDzD$tf_?yaVdRld2Upÿ#Ƣ>EW5wGfPGHc!?#}uG#x/AhjZڮFbK=dߧ]#,.ƅ|1}2n^ĕ|k y:]-aT֨rejE_NJֵ&[)F?w}҄mqC vr;^fT^d$GYJwsrI3DC_8fR|B"iCJƜ}=hb +'{'tsڱ^~$$]Щݷ!IӭG8k*gY7J~^Hyf]W?Z{cT\ۧwr\nE1d)(Ehlgvuz FxWb*?tTkub_( nuiIX5X=R$zJI9L"M^h-^Y{[9rc 2Sb z&Ȓ-tiD&}Wi a,3 c~EXo0$o+`8WX=>|I(^v[oI@qIQ>$FM|\WR/{idjX$usaZKIթ`̄R4nVY3.JR+' X$2x晣ߝ˻z~{H\ȽJ傁-8e7, +v’Gg"}%|[THgF{B)-~%q? J9nh$K#54+媷`إ Vu꠬U3!b@VQo@LdӐѰ{OQ7Xkyplȍ1j їџ {\):#냑v]YWbJ9tlqv{mfa{30v([:~o%JޗgD0[V/z9,bv"셈&xŏ&V;'Ԅ8K7-kȻA-QT|=8 j~o"U83e-)o}Fz18#\)/)\!mIdd.Ϭѵ*)9G@ʼl<$d'OycZ~3kqеXOO))]sw[]j% h&v&!FcOYNZl;0CS/ *"@*7%?#8iY&,aqIf Fv1bI-}$H,2GA&~2 SupzrX[(B$b" tkjN\vscY5֨URr>AJqNwO]w| RѪxe(<A~/ s齵̖ڲOH_A՚Z˻ʼntDzKg.OCSxbI/S#'/toBP! Xp2ܐ1!n$Y^ Nv{cWbX/YG㍎㯣gO.WxӪ"޶r!8Ҿw9e\C\lD a+$RV=my+&&"RŶ]Yeͩf o,ɋSfƺ.ӈ/vg=j;// -|0Q:PMv$ QXpV׎Cc'2j#uMwgDNqzufab1xvTPn{EmΊgTKy5?fuK-Mֳ2l2IJ*{w3׶3 !^ҽ?^;9~۱ƦJ8X3Ms ShOаquJ/ {r1}8^~ׅ}`ᾼ=?K=]c[Cl!t݋89*4#K=[}.z+aID]ݹs%P][|-Fei/229|t rk/n 0檐|\)"e:!"ԟCr#^)1I[HQ4Z!S6kS(&.g16Y C+e5&Dc-[0{Kꢩ 愓Xi%~KȥձFw׍ki\!ZG?XEؔ"w2"YLa#9at<WڊO'C)d4'P<03]࢕Ė2ӅpMIڧLd`ܴIE$tnECT!tgE\ni5|˲wظ׿{?~+磉&^5&pvZ*QlB848?fMu3ZviAt~FD ƾ삨]%SӚOZ)gy1{^,WFj)dznXn^\~0[_:eĪb G' ;FLK[Lߪϯ䉄;=/Nv./}/;T3NȔ"gb7-`O@[:V +yA0J< .+"Oѱtq/ DZd5J+p 8Q0aM5'6aQIâcsIr0Ƨ\lY¨*fȻϯw ՜Xۗ)8zT-%Г%QyT._wMLFXV*y䕨/m h֐{^""ΉiCoI1i"^Xow[CȞ:A:ӕN=;qM)Oڦ#N+-7 %+cB5rnpȊ-8-.:UL u r!]Ч2/L db,˷_ ҂1=9,z/ ŀez!c"pLƏwA3,opoj$CdLemÄ6 哊 9"T7'y<@CUzVZ# ؖp2Z0Z* #GkhѠ1.w;[ ~en̷Hb|@YMn>(fXg襸>pK^qTgmhqBGK" {15ґk%X&1;km*f.$O{VV_7 筪I\ƌJN<&o}ՙI 2=Hgi/mvB`ڎ+{Xanf'Ő͵pP\uH\O-Ph"a/ (s>6TQâ V-#xrmîx^Pg%WPp)N ț͘M8l$'oX~nf ?kLq 瑯}ocy?HNqd,yRq EY4Ur O;CpxymI|C~#ؾrs튰W?Zcd\[y*t^wm>}8yAP67s2ռ䓨Ou10[:;Ƃ;/㚽g 'yz?D\|+m8_Ut'qaBՄIMnc/ɷIWv +E6BZ i\EG8q:%k%!D* A7M'./O4iar1amQbV8k}H;HX 2PPNQ+ӎwxĚ+} * GAuDVqKWmW*L0(;vw11TJ oȮs>Aœ < #/cL°,x.EY9xC*Rhc\@U]t׾c,ezO.b໓Q^$r _Ǥp)Yoh6bM!{AfìL7yAj:j O^1: >e4gߛY`?|âG#IAwIrB<(zQ:C`-cos4jtAl ? k;٦lo#}1x;9e~ 5Pն3XAH}j[(l8jM% W/fڂYb-˭z]A=RFd8=ZrO4{U%E-HKnbqa CCЉvp g7|3Հ/_Ty#3aS'*JXsAT0Sj[&vP g,(cj7[;\n>cW . $IizEqCLj4:UBIX S$5du+[>$!41Ac6G0x33=ڮaRq@oxmztV!b?GruЀ,0S?Q$uח)Dyf'eU-=vƥïB,`l'>K M 0|[c2\2ج>}>O=ɧޏx$1<"szOfV@>3g陝v/Gk8[4<KJ3,ɯ)E(>ikVUrӋyt3SsQp[DҞ78w?O t>KRK"b](̙AͅS mm-H"nj`-Bnq}QzNOY !fg=jzB*萄ifGUBL#՚nƉןO@>X=rF0[$W!#ޣ7MeM;Ϧ~ 7MX{ —Ո9%|,Lg<5l`o*cѬ 4~v͍PBƌ4!]tQ3> ^g4UЀSYY\q"Nn-_Iůg6nH Í͒w${O0~OP]"T4#VpNh0O6vpJ<#ͱ~n5Ŏ'z[چ<4fb;Rn![c ~/d\\e]Џ߲wK4̈_O?اh?TL@>vUkW1ʖ`wov+\@+ Q>FDkᷲ_# J$ yDs_7@&nz _z=ҹ@(pVЫUlPoQ#(؝CBJ?BZSgec傊xog2P*FH,!gm<\lV6|qMFXk2lƬhSF< jxY3V![RUM=}9u+_ke _G߹k`gcTMMMtGpp$hn.qU렀_ "nkVY ?Qd Nw]@wWjTZ$UQ0T T 7Iڟ+JmޮGh46+_*-5_3_wߞYAmQAH'"B!B` } EnTTWUPS7Qw,#rmw=_j%?ˈG_Q{'hm'd/sį=:qR' l쁒S Jd)=*M+{GT (@:Y0*Bwb(}n`Z`9AQ:|gzQZ\PG-3=L]ֿuTu3AN|: